14-Year-Old Stabs Teacher at Benfeld School as Motive Remains Unknown

Emergency support has been activated for students and staff after the arrest of the wounded suspect.

Overview

  • The 66-year-old music teacher was hospitalized with facial injuries and her life is not in danger, according to authorities.
  • Police arrested the student about an hour after the attack as he tried to leave the area; he inflicted throat wounds on himself and was taken to hospital in critical condition.
  • Roughly 800 students were evacuated from the Robert‑Schuman institute in Benfeld as security forces secured the campus.
  • Investigators say they are not treating the case as terrorism and have not established a motive.
  • Resigned education minister Élisabeth Borne condemned the assault, said she would go to the scene, and confirmed an emergency unit was mobilized to support the school community.
